Ericaphis wakibae (Hottes, 1934)

Material. 2 fund., No 10276, SSWBer, Dryas octopetala asiatica (Nakai) Nakai, 8.vii.2012, on flowering shoots near flowers; 1 apt., No. 10266, SSWBer, Polygonum tripterocarpum A. Gray ex Rothr. (?accidentally), 30.vii.2012, on leaf.

Comments. The single apterous viviparous female was collected from Polygonum tripterocarpum A. Gray ex Rothr. and than was brought to the laboratory and put in a cage with a set of plants consisting of Polygonum tripterocarpum, Vaccinium uliginosum L. and Dasiphora fruticosa (L.) Rydb. The aphid began to feed on V. uliginosum and bore 8 nymphs, but none of them grew to adulthood.

Distribution outside Chukotka AO. North America, introduced to the United Kingdom.
